The Victoria and Albert (V&A) Museum in London is unveiling NAOMI: In Fashion, a landmark exhibition dedicated to the illustrious career of iconic model Naomi Campbell. This immersive experience, opening in June and running until April 2025, marks a first for the museum.

Curated in collaboration with Campbell herself, the exhibition promises a unique perspective on the fashion industry through the lens of one of its most influential figures. NAOMI: In Fashion will showcase Campbell’s impact on the runway and beyond, highlighting her creative collaborations, activism, and enduring cultural influence.

At the heart of the exhibition will be a stunning collection of fashion. Visitors can expect to see an extensive collection of garments and accessories, meticulously chosen to represent key moments in Campbell’s career. The V&A will draw upon Campbell’s own extensive wardrobe, featuring both haute couture and ready-to-wear pieces.

Alongside these personal treasures, the exhibition will include loans from prestigious designer archives, ensuring a comprehensive exploration of Campbell’s fashion journey.

The influence of leading global designers will be a major theme. Vistors can expect to see iconic creations from the likes of Alexander McQueen, Azzedine Alaïa, Burberry, Chanel, and Gianni Versace. These garments are set to be presented alongside photographs that capture Campbell’s captivating presence on camera.

BOSS will be sponsoring the NAOMI: In Fashion exhibition. This prestigious partnership underscores the deep connection between Campbell and the fashion house.

Visitors can expect to see a complete look from the Fall/Winter 2023 BOSS runway collection, personally worn by Campbell in the brand’s #BeYourOwnBOSS campaign. This inclusion, hand-picked by the V&A’s Senior Fashion Curator Sonnet Stanfill, highlights the significant impact of their ongoing collaboration throughout Campbell’s career.

Campbell’s groundbreaking achievements throughout her 40-year career will be woven into the narrative. The exhibition will acknowledge her role in breaking racial barriers in the fashion industry, as well as explore Campbell’s activism and philanthropic work, showcasing her commitment to various social causes.

NAOMI: In Fashion promises to be a captivating experience for fashion enthusiasts and museum-goers alike. By celebrating Campbell’s remarkable career, the V&A underscores the significant role models play in shaping the fashion landscape.
